Janari, Notorious Kidnapper, Killed In Kaduna Air Strikes, Says NAF


A well-known terrorist and kidnap kingpin popularly known as Janari and several members of his syndicate have been killed by the air strikes undertaken by the air component of Operation WHIRL PUNCH.

A statement by the Director of Public Relations and Information of the Nigerian Air Force, Air Vice Marshal Edward Gabkwet on Sunday, January 21 said Janari and his cohorts have been responsible for numerous attacks and abductions within Kaduna State as well as along the Abuja-Kaduna highway.

According to Gabkwet, the strikes were authorized after Janari and his gang were sighted at a location near Gadar Katako in Igabi Local Government Area of Kaduna State.

He posited that further exploitation revealed that they were massing up for a likely attack or kidnapping of vulnerable civilians, hence the need to immediately attack the location.

The Air Force spokesperson explained that intelligence received after the strike revealed that Janari was indeed eliminated alongside many other terrorists/kidnappers.

He said similar air strikes were also carried out on January 20, 2024, on confirmed terrorists and kidnappers’ hideouts near Chukuba in Niger State with various degrees of success.

“Feedback after the strikes was also positive as it confirmed that the targets were neutralized, and their mobility destroyed,” he stated.
